gbcc.web.unc.eduThe mission of the Graduate Business & Consulting Club (GBCC) is to educate and inform advanced professional students about non-academic careers in science through events, seminars, and competitions. GBCC provides students with the resources to develop key skills in the business world, including professional networking, introduction to business concepts, and consulting case interview practice. Beyond the Bench Beyond the Bench is a monthly GBCC seminar series aimed at creating a platform for PhD/ADC students and post-doctoral fellows interested in non-academic career paths. Professionals from various fields, including business development, management consulting, and medical writing are frequent Beyond the Bench speakers. Monthly Networking Social: The goal of this event series is to facilitate interaction between students interested in pursuing careers in business, consulting, and other non-academic fields. Cases & Cases Cases & Cases is a weekly case practice session for students and post-doc interested in learning about consulting and the case interview process. Carolina Graduate Consulting Group The Carolina Graduate Consulting Group (CG^2), a branch of the GBCC, conducts pro-bono life science consulting projects with groups at UNC and organizations within the Triangle.
